Bunk beds might seem like a simple choice for siblings who wish to share bedrooms, but it's important to choose the right one so that your kiddos will have plenty of sleep and avoid any potential hazards. Choose a bunk bed that can be able to grow with your child, and be divided into two separate beds when they reach their teens. In addition, consider the height of the top bunk -If it's too low or too high will affect your child's ability and comfort to move up and down independently.

If you're concerned about the security of bunk beds, pick one that meets third-party testing standards and includes guardrails on both sides. While lofts and bunks bed are a stylish, space-saving option for bedrooms, only older children who can comply with safe sleeping rules are allowed to use the top level.

Lofts and bunks come in different finishes which makes them a flexible choice for any kids' room decor. They also work in shared bedrooms for siblings or friends who might be staying with. Look for bunks that have strong guardrails that extend all the way to the ceiling. This will ensure the safety of both highest occupants. These railings are usually located at the corners of the upper and side bunks. They also extend outwards from both the headboard and the footboard to give additional stability.
